Friendly fare for Beanibazar CC
Poplar's Beanibazar Cricket Club played a friendly at Victoria Park - Credit: Archant
Poplar club plays match in Victoria Park to raise profile
Beanibazar Cricket Club UK played out an enjoyable Victoria Park friendly to help promote the Poplar-based club.
The match was also an opportunity to sign up new recruits and encourage networking, with Team Dalim dismissed for 156 after leading contributions from Hasan (35), Rubel (33) and Kahir (29).
Tuhin was the pick of the bowlers with three wickets and he was supported by Shiplu and Ashraf, who both took two each.
Team Rashal reached their target with two wickets to spare, with leading scores made by Jabir (40), Sufian (35), Ashraf (28) and captain Rashal (11), while Saidur took three wickets and there were two apiece for Rumon and Khaled.

Beanibazar Sporting Club vice-president Mahbub Ahmed Ranu said: “There is a lot of talent amongst these boys. The game was played in great spirit and has highlighted the depth of our talent. I’m glad everybody had a good day.”
